The lecture ‘J.R.R. Tolkien: An Imaginative Life’ is now available online: A series of three lectures examining Tolkien and his imaginative experience is now becoming available online in audio and illustrated format. The lecture series runs from February 10 to March 17, 2009 at Westminster College in Salt Lake City. As the series is completed, all lectures will be made available for online listening and viewing. The first lecture is already available. For more information visit gnosis.org/tolkien

Lecture II: There and Back Again Tuesday, February 24, 2009 at 7:30 p.m.
Lecture III: Tolkien and the Imaginative Tradition Tuesday, March 17, 2009 at 7:30 p.m.

All lectures begin at 7:30 p.m. and will be held on the Westminster College campus, in the Gore Business Auditorium, 1840 S 1300 E, Salt Lake City, UT
